Ten Commandments of Leadership-Not Being a Wimp
Wimp. Wiener. Coward. Spineless. Jellyfish. And more not fit to print. All are words used to describe someone who lacks courage. The courage to do the right thing. The courage to confront. The courage to object. The courage to take risks. The courage to take a different path. All of these are needed characteristics of effective and winning leadership. In all types of settings and in all organizational structures, leaders need courage and, more importantly, the good judgment when to utilize courage and when to stand down. As important as courage is, the ability to not fight a battle is equally important.

Fear, Courage and Success
Fear can -- and will -- paralyze you. It can keep you from reaching the career and life success you want and deserve. If you develop the habit of courage, you can beat fear. Repetition is the best way to develop the habit of being courageous. The more you are willing to face your fears -- small and large -- and act, the quicker courage will become one of the guiding habits in your life.
